Social Indicators: Substance Abuse
Drug abuse was confined mainly to the poor and certain subcultures until recently. Drug abuse escalated and entered mainstream culture during the 1960s and 1970s. Few reliable time-series statistics exist that measure levels of drug abuse over an extended period. The most widely used statistics come from the National Household Survey on Drug Abuse (NHSDA).…
